Career Opportunities

A Diploma in Electrical Technology offers some of the most secure and prestigious job roles in the country. Our graduates can work as Sub-Assistant Engineers in:
  • Power Generation: BPDB (Bangladesh Power Development Board), EGCB, and Ashuganj Power Station.

  • Distribution & Transmission: PGCB, DESCO, DPDC, WZPDCL, and NESCO.

  • Telecommunications: BTCL and private mobile network operators (Grameenphone, Banglalink, etc.).

  • Infrastructure: Bangladesh Railway, Civil Aviation, and Seaports.

  • Real Estate & Industry: Electrical safety and maintenance in high-rise buildings, garments, and pharmaceuticals.

  • Government Organizations: PWD, LGED, and various city corporations.

Importance of Practical Education

Electrical technology cannot be learned only from textbooks. At SRAIST, we emphasize “learning by doing.” Our Electrical Department features modern labs where students work with the same equipment used in the industry:
  • Electrical Circuits Lab: Testing AC/DC circuits and measuring electrical parameters.
  • Electrical Machines Lab: Hands-on training with Motors, Generators, and Transformers.
  • Digital Electronics & Microprocessor Lab: Learning about automated control systems.
  • Wiring & Installation Workshop: Mastering domestic and industrial wiring standards.
  • Power System & Protection Lab: Understanding switchgear, circuit breakers, and relay operations.
This rigorous practical training ensures that our students can confidently handle complex electrical systems from day one of their careers.
